Output 775801b941ba5819af233bfd78fd270606d4cfd5b7b706f336de99a453395d0d:0

value
652217973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7073e19c95e553e154b5e690076df5402bcc6e15 OP_EQUAL
address
3BwcRbtVPLhT3xK52YJ7GAkegF7XwXyojU
transaction
775801b941ba5819af233bfd78fd270606d4cfd5b7b706f336de99a453395d0d
spent
true